CHELSEA IN KANE SWAP PROPOSAL

Chelsea are reportedly willing to offer several different players, including Tammy Abraham and Kepa Arrizabalaga, in a player-plus-cash offer for Harry Kane, according to ESPN Football.

The Blues have joined the race for the England skipper, after it emerged that he wants to quit the club after another trophyless campaign.

Manchester City are the current favourites to sign the 27-year-old, but neighbours United are also in the running. Liverpool have even been mentioned by one pundit.

Spurs chairman Daniel Levy is set to demand well in excess of £120million for his talismanic frontman. However, ESPN claims that Chelsea will throw in the caveat of landing some of their players in return, along with cash to try and tempt Levy into a deal.

Their main fear, though, is that Levy will refuse to do any deal with a London rival.

Spurs and Chelsea have a fractious relationship going back to when Levy would not allow Luka Modric to move to Stamford Bridge in 2011. The Blues also beat Tottenham to the signing of Willian, after the Brazilian had agreed terms to head to White Hart Lane.

As for the players on offer in the proposed swap, striker Abraham is available after falling out of favour under Thomas Tuchel.

The England international has hardly got a look-in over the last month, with his last Premier League goal coming back in December. West Ham have also been linked with the frontman, who is valued by Chelsea at around £40m.

As for Kepa, the Spaniard has found himself playing second fiddle to Edouard Mendy, despite Chelsea paying £71.4m to Atletico Madrid for his services in 2018.

Tottenham have been rumoured to be ready to move on from current No.1 Hugo Lloris, although a recent report suggested he could be close to a new deal.

Hudson-Odoi another alternative

One other source claimed that winger Callum Hudson-Odoi could be another alternative, given he has started just 10 Premier League games all season.

Bayern Munich previously showed an interest in the 20-year-old attacker, whose ability to play wide on the right would fit a potential need for Spurs as Gareth Bale prepares to head back to Real Madrid.

But whatever happens with Kane looks set to drag over the course of the summer, particularly if a bidding war begins for arguably the best striker in the Premier League.
